Iron is one of the most essential minerals for the human body. It plays a central role in various physiological functions, especially the production of hemoglobin, a protein in red blood cells responsible for carrying oxygen from the lungs to the rest of the body. When your iron levels drop too low, your body struggles to produce enough healthy red blood cells, leading to a condition called iron deficiency anemia.
Iron deficiency is the most common nutritional deficiency worldwide, affecting over 1.6 billion people. While it’s often seen as a simple lack of dietary iron, the reality is more complex. There are multiple reasons why your body may lack iron—even if you eat what you think is a healthy diet.

Why Is Iron Important for Your Body?
Iron is a micronutrient that your body needs in small amounts, but its impact is huge. Here’s what iron helps your body do:
- Transport oxygen via hemoglobin in red blood cells
- Store oxygen in muscles through a protein called myoglobin
- Support cellular function, energy production, and DNA synthesis
- Boost the immune system, helping fight off infections
- Aid cognitive function, especially in children and pregnant women
Without adequate iron, all of these systems can become compromised, leading to both short-term and long-term health consequences.
What Is Iron Deficiency?
Iron deficiency happens when your body doesn’t have enough iron to produce adequate amounts of hemoglobin. Without sufficient hemoglobin, your muscles and tissues won’t get enough oxygen, which can cause fatigue and other health issues.
Common Causes of Iron Deficiency
Let’s explore the top reasons why iron deficiency may occur:
Inadequate Iron Intake
The most straightforward cause is not consuming enough iron through your diet. People at risk include:
- Vegetarians or vegans
- People with restrictive diets or eating disorders
- Individuals in regions where iron-rich foods are scarce
There are two types of dietary iron:
- Heme iron – Found in animal products (red meat, poultry, fish); easily absorbed.
- Non-heme iron – Found in plant-based foods (lentils, spinach, tofu); harder for the body to absorb.
A diet lacking in heme iron or not properly combining non-heme iron with vitamin C-rich foods can lead to a slow but steady depletion of iron stores.
Chronic Blood Loss
Iron is lost when you lose blood, since red blood cells contain a large amount of it. Some common causes of chronic blood loss include:
- Heavy menstrual periods (common in women aged 15–49)
- Gastrointestinal bleeding due to ulcers, polyps, hemorrhoids, or colorectal cancer
- Regular blood donations
- Internal bleeding from injuries, surgeries, or chronic conditions like inflammatory bowel disease (IBD)
Even small but persistent blood loss can deplete iron reserves over time.
Increased Iron Requirements
Certain life stages and situations increase the body’s demand for iron:
- Pregnancy: The body needs more iron to support the growing fetus and placenta.
- Breastfeeding: Iron is used to produce nutrient-rich breast milk.
- Rapid growth: Infants, toddlers, and teenagers need more iron due to physical growth spurts.
- Athletes: Especially females and endurance athletes, who may lose iron through sweat or microscopic bleeding in the gastrointestinal tract due to intense activity.
If these increased needs aren’t met through diet or supplements, iron deficiency can develop quickly.
Poor Iron Absorption
Even if your diet includes iron-rich foods, your body might not be absorbing it effectively. Absorption can be impaired by:
- Celiac disease or gluten intolerance
- Crohn’s disease or ulcerative colitis
- Gastric bypass surgery or other surgeries that reduce stomach acid
- Use of antacids or proton pump inhibitors (PPIs)
Iron is best absorbed in an acidic environment. Conditions or medications that reduce stomach acid also reduce the body’s ability to absorb iron.
Low Vitamin C Intake
Vitamin C plays a crucial role in enhancing the absorption of non-heme iron from plant-based foods. Without adequate vitamin C, much of the iron consumed is not absorbed and is excreted instead.
Frequent Blood Donations or Medical Conditions
Giving blood frequently without proper replenishment of iron stores can lead to deficiency. Medical conditions that may also cause blood loss or destroy red blood cells include:
- Chronic kidney disease
- Cancer (especially gastrointestinal)
- Malaria (in endemic areas)
- Autoimmune disorders
Vegetarian or Vegan Diet
Non-heme iron (from plant-based sources) is harder for the body to absorb compared to heme iron (from animal sources). Without proper planning, vegetarians and vegans may become iron deficient.
Symptoms of Iron Deficiency
Early-stage iron deficiency can be mild and go unnoticed, but as it progresses, symptoms may include:
- Fatigue or tiredness
- Pale skin
- Shortness of breath
- Dizziness or lightheadedness
- Cold hands and feet
- Brittle nails
- Headaches
- Chest pain (in severe cases)

How Is Iron Deficiency Diagnosed?
Doctors use several tests to diagnose iron deficiency, including:
- Complete Blood Count (CBC) – to check for anemia.
- Serum Ferritin – measures iron storage levels.
- Serum Iron and Total Iron Binding Capacity (TIBC) – shows how much iron is in your blood and how well it binds.
- Transferrin Saturation – measures the percentage of transferrin (iron transport protein) that is saturated with iron.
Your doctor may also investigate underlying causes like gastrointestinal bleeding or absorption disorders if your deficiency is unexplained.
Treatment for Iron Deficiency
Dietary Changes
Eating iron-rich foods is the first step. Key sources include:
Animal-based (heme iron):
- Red meat (beef, lamb)
- Chicken and turkey
- Liver and organ meats
- Shellfish (oysters, clams)
Plant-based (non-heme iron):
- Spinach, kale, and other leafy greens
- Lentils, beans, chickpeas
- Tofu and tempeh
- Pumpkin seeds, sesame seeds
- Iron-fortified cereals and bread
Boost absorption with Vitamin C: Pair iron-rich meals with oranges, tomatoes, bell peppers, or strawberries.
Iron Supplements
Iron tablets or syrups are commonly prescribed. These may cause side effects like constipation, nausea, or dark stools. Always follow the dosage given by your doctor.
Tip: Taking iron on an empty stomach improves absorption, but taking it with food may reduce side effects.
Intravenous Iron Therapy
In cases of severe deficiency or poor absorption, iron may be delivered directly into the bloodstream via IV therapy. This is faster and more effective for some patients.
Treating Underlying Conditions
If the deficiency is due to bleeding or chronic disease, treating the root cause is crucial. For example:
- Treating inflammation that interferes with absorption
- Managing menstrual disorders
- Addressing gastrointestinal conditions
- Stopping NSAID use (if causing ulcers)
Prevention: How to Avoid Iron Deficiency
Here are practical ways to prevent iron deficiency in your daily life:
- Get regular blood tests if you’re at high risk
- Eat a balanced diet with both heme and non-heme iron sources
- Pair plant-based iron with vitamin C
- Avoid drinking tea or coffee with meals (they can inhibit iron absorption)
- Take iron supplements if prescribed by your doctor

Frequently Asked Questions (FAQs)
1. What are the first signs of iron deficiency?
A: Fatigue, pale skin, and shortness of breath are often the first noticeable symptoms.
2. Can I treat iron deficiency with food alone?
A: Mild deficiency can often be corrected through diet. Moderate to severe cases usually require iron supplements.
3. Is iron deficiency the same as anemia?
A: Iron deficiency can cause anemia, but not all anemia is due to iron deficiency.
4. How long does it take to recover from iron deficiency?
A: With proper treatment, most people feel better in a few weeks, but full recovery may take a few months.
5. Can children have iron deficiency?
A: Yes, especially during growth spurts. Iron is crucial for brain development and physical growth in children.
